The TLV2548QDWR is a precision 12-bit analog-to-digital converter (ADC) with a serial interface from Texas Instruments. Designed to deliver high-performance data conversion with low power consumption, this device is ideal for a wide range of applications, including industrial control systems, medical equipment, and data acquisition systems.
Key Features:
- Resolution: 12-bit ADC offering fine granularity for precise measurements.
- Channels: 8-channel multiplexer allows for multiple signal inputs, increasing system versatility.
- Interface: Serial interface ensures easy integration with microcontrollers and digital systems.
- Sample Rate: High-speed sampling up to 200 kSPS (kilo-samples per second) enables real-time data processing.
- Power Supply: Operates from a 2.7V to 5.5V power supply, accommodating a variety of power environments.
- Package: Supplied in a compact 20-pin SOIC package, optimizing board space.
- Power-Down Mode: Features a power-down mode to conserve energy when the ADC is not in use.

The TLV2548QDWR is designed with an internal 4.096V reference, providing a high degree of accuracy and eliminating the need for external precision reference components. Its low power consumption and power-down feature make it suitable for battery-operated devices where power efficiency is crucial. Additionally, its robust design includes features such as overvoltage protection for the analog inputs, ensuring reliability and durability in harsh environments.
